Company Apex is a mid-size international agricultural company that uses virtual global teams. The company is headquartered in the Midwest of the United States but has operations located in Guam, Japan, and Italy. The company has experienced steady growth within the last 10 years and is on track to continue that growth for the next 10-20 years. The vice president of international operations is a newly appointed woman, aged 35, with 10 years of experience working in the agriculture industry and 5 years in the international field. The company has decided there is a need to use virtual global teams but has encountered two challenges - communication and access.

Communication is a challenge in traditional agile environments, but that challenge is made even more difficult among distributed teams. The primary reason is that distributed teams are limited in their communication channels. For example, while co-located teams face each other in a stand-up meeting, distributed teams often face a speakerphone. Given that so much of communication is nonverbal, the distributed teams are disadvantaged by their circumstances. Because of this lack of communication, the relationships are hindered, and members have not developed the trust required to speak sincerely during meetings.
